Simple Tin Planter

As you ramp up your spring gardening efforts, think about the easy ways to make your potted plants look stylish. You can convert a basic wooden planter into a statement garden piece by hammering tin tiles onto the wood. Tin is a cinch to cut and looks great when attached with decorative upholstery tacks.
